Lecturers confirmed during a workshop organized by the General Pension and Social Insurance Authority that registration of citizens working in any of the entities covered by the federal pension law is mandatory, based on what is stipulated in the law, which obliges all work in the public and private sectors, which are subject to its provisions, to register and participate. The applicant must be at least 18 years of age and not more than 60 years of age, and be fit to work when appointed under a medical report from the approved medical authority.

They pointed out that the law entrusted it with the responsibility of registration, and the payment of subscription for it, starting from the date of joining the work, and reinforced this responsibility by imposing additional fines in the case of failure to register and subscribe for them, and the procedural steps to apply to the service through the Authority's website, explaining each The operations of the insured registration application from the beginning of his enrollment until his registration.

The workshop was attended by more than 150 employers in the public and private sectors, where they focused on reviewing the most important e-services, including registration services, which included the registration of a new employer, registration of a new insured, and the registration service of Gulf nationals working in the State, within the system of extending insurance protection. The lecturers pointed out that to be subject to the employer under the umbrella of the Authority should have at least one Emirati or Gulf employees, and generally subject to the provisions of the law employers in the federal and local government, regardless of the emirate of the workplace, with the exception of the local and private sector in the Emirate of Abu Dhabi The local sector in the emirate of Sharjah means the federal sector, public authorities, institutions and companies, and banks to which the federal government or local government entities request the emirate's government, and the private sector means any natural or legal person using Workers who are citizens for wages of any kind.

The lecturers stressed the mandatory insurance of Gulf nationals working in the country, according to the system of extending insurance protection, which is concerned with extending the insurance umbrella to GCC citizens working outside their countries, according to their regulations.
